In the realm of digital signal processing, various techniques are employed to optimize the transmission and storage of information. One such technique that has gained attention is high information delta modulation. This method is particularly useful in scenarios where bandwidth is limited, and efficiency is paramount. To better understand this concept, it is essential to break down its components and explore its applications.Delta modulation, at its core, is a method of encoding analog signals into digital form. It works by transmitting the difference between the current sample and the previous sample, rather than sending the absolute values of each sample. This approach reduces the amount of data that needs to be transmitted, making it an efficient solution for many applications. However, traditional delta modulation can suffer from limitations in terms of fidelity and the ability to capture rapid changes in the signal.This is where high information delta modulation comes into play. By enhancing the basic principles of delta modulation, this advanced technique allows for a higher resolution of the transmitted signal. It achieves this by employing a more sophisticated algorithm that can adjust the step size of the modulation based on the characteristics of the input signal. As a result, high information delta modulation can provide a more accurate representation of the original signal, even in the presence of rapid fluctuations.The advantages of high information delta modulation extend beyond just improved fidelity. It also offers significant benefits in terms of bandwidth efficiency. In many communication systems, especially those involving wireless transmissions, conserving bandwidth is crucial. By utilizing high information delta modulation, engineers can transmit high-quality audio or video signals without overwhelming the available bandwidth. This is particularly important in mobile communications, where users expect high-definition content without delays or interruptions.Moreover, high information delta modulation can be applied in various fields, including telecommunications, medical imaging, and even audio processing. For instance, in medical imaging, where precision is critical, this technique can enhance the quality of images captured from imaging devices, leading to better diagnostics and treatment outcomes. In audio processing, it allows for clearer sound reproduction, which is essential for music and voice applications.Despite its numerous benefits, implementing high information delta modulation does come with challenges. The complexity of the algorithms required for effective delta modulation means that more processing power is needed, which can be a limitation in some low-power devices. Additionally, while the technique improves signal representation, it still requires careful consideration of noise and distortion, which can affect the overall performance.In conclusion, high information delta modulation represents a significant advancement in the field of digital signal processing.
